Heather McPherson is a Canadian politician and New Democratic Party (NDP) member of Parliament for Edmonton Strathcona, Alberta. First elected in 2019, she has been re-elected in subsequent federal elections and served in several caucus and critic roles. In 2026, she ran for the federal NDP leadership and finished second.
Early life and education
Heather McPherson was born in Edmonton, Alberta. Public profiles say she studied at the University of Alberta and completed a master’s degree in education-related studies.
Political career
McPherson entered the House of Commons in 2019 as the MP for Edmonton Strathcona and was re-elected in later federal elections. Parliamentary profiles identify her as an NDP MP representing Alberta.
Parliamentary roles
Public sources describe McPherson as having served in party and critic roles, including as foreign affairs critic. Media coverage also notes her work on issues such as international affairs and Alberta-related federal policy.
2026 NDP leadership race
McPherson entered the 2026 federal NDP leadership contest. Reports say she finished second in the first round behind Avi Lewis.
